Approach 1: Sensata Technologies Holding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) Analysis
A Discounted Cash Flow, or DCF, model estimates what a company could be worth by projecting its future cash flows and then discounting those back to today using a required rate of return. It focuses on cash that can be returned to shareholders rather than accounting earnings.
For Sensata Technologies Holding, the model used is a 2 Stage Free Cash Flow to Equity approach. The latest twelve month free cash flow is about $471.2 million. Analysts provide specific free cash flow estimates for the next several years, then Simply Wall St extends those projections further. For example, projected free cash flow for 2030 is $583.5 million, with intermediate annual estimates between 2026 and 2035 discounted back to today.
Adding those discounted cash flows together gives an estimated intrinsic value of about $39.58 per share. With the current share price around $40.67, the DCF suggests the stock is roughly 2.8% above this estimate, which is a very small gap that can easily sit within normal modelling error.
Result: ABOUT RIGHT

Approach 2: Sensata Technologies Holding Price vs Sales
For companies that generate revenue consistently, the P/S ratio is a useful way to think about value, because it compares what investors are paying to each dollar of sales, regardless of short term swings in earnings.
What counts as a "normal" P/S ratio depends on how quickly revenue is expected to grow and how risky the business is. Higher expected growth or lower perceived risk usually support a higher multiple, while slower growth or higher risk tend to justify a lower one.
Sensata Technologies Holding currently trades on a P/S of 1.60x. This sits below the Electrical industry average P/S of 2.33x and also below the peer group average of 8.31x. Simply Wall St’s Fair Ratio for Sensata is 1.51x. This is its proprietary estimate of what a reasonable P/S might be after factoring in elements such as earnings growth, profit margins, industry, market cap and company specific risks.
Because the Fair Ratio blends these company characteristics directly, it offers a more tailored reference point than broad industry or peer comparisons, which may include businesses with very different profiles.
With a current P/S of 1.60x versus a Fair Ratio of 1.51x, Sensata’s valuation looks slightly higher than that model suggests.
Result: OVERVALUED

For Sensata Technologies Holding, here are previews of two leading Sensata Technologies Holding Narratives to help frame the investment case:
Fair value in this bullish narrative: US$48.00 per share
Implied discount to that fair value at US$40.67: about 15.3% lower than the narrative fair value
Revenue growth assumption: 5.23% a year
- Focuses on higher future earnings power from margin expansion, stronger free cash flow and lower capital intensity.
- Sees growth potential in electrification, leak detection and industrial automation, with a tilt toward higher margin, recurring style revenues.
- Accepts meaningful risks from EV adoption, price pressure in China and regulation, but assumes these are outweighed by execution and product wins.
Fair value in this bearish narrative: US$34.00 per share
Implied premium to that fair value at US$40.67: about 19.6% above the narrative fair value
Revenue growth assumption: 2.55% a year
- Highlights pressure from regionalised supply chains, regulation and cost inflation that could weigh on margins and earnings.
- Frames customer concentration, legacy internal combustion exposure and sensor commoditisation as key threats to pricing power and demand.
- Recognises growth efforts in EV safety and other segments, but treats them as insufficient to fully offset the headwinds in the base business.
Together, these two narratives outline a valuation range and a concrete set of business conditions that would need to hold for either view to be persuasive.
